STS054-72-025 - STS-054 - IUS/TDRS-F drifts above the Earth's surface after STS-54 deployment

description

Summary

The original finding aid described this as:

Description: The inertial upper stage (IUS) / Tracking and Data Relay Satellite F (TDRS-F) spacecraft combination is backdropped against the clouds over Earth after its release from Endeavour, Orbiter Vehicle (OV) 105.

Subject Terms: STS-54, ENDEAVOUR (ORBITER), EARTH OBSERVATIONS (FROM SPACE), EARTH LIMB, TDR SATELLITES, CLOUDS

Date Taken: 1/13/1993
